Across the reviewers we read, the TP-Link Archer BE400 (BE6500) is the cheapest Wi-Fi 7 router that the high-trust crowd takes seriously. RTINGS describes it as delivering impressive wireless speeds that can take advantage of a roughly 1.5 Gbps internet connection, with dual 2.5 Gbps ports and a quad-core CPU. TweakTown and Dong Knows Tech frame it as 'Wi-Fi 7 on a budget' — solid for gigabit-plus broadband but with predictable compromises versus tri-band Wi-Fi 7 flagships.
r/HomeNetworking threads echo that framing. Owners coming from ISP gateways report meaningful real-world speed jumps after switching, while more demanding users point out it's dual-band rather than tri-band, so there's no dedicated 6 GHz radio and MLO benefits are limited. RTINGS and reviewers consistently note the maximum wireless throughput trails more expensive routers, which is expected for the price tier.
For a buyer who wants future-proofing into Wi-Fi 7 client devices without paying for a flagship, the consensus verdict is that this is the safe entry point. The Amazon rating of 4.4 across 1,000+ reviews corroborates the expert tier's lukewarm-but-positive take.

- 𝐅𝐮𝐭𝐮𝐫𝐞-𝐑𝐞𝐚𝐝𝐲 𝐖𝐢-𝐅𝐢 𝟕 - Designed with the latest Wi-Fi 7 technology, featuring Multi-Link Operation (MLO), Multi-RUs, and 4K-QAM. Achieve optimized performance on latest WiFi 7 laptops and devices, like the iPhone 16 Pro, and Samsung Galaxy S24 Ultra.

- 𝟔-𝐒𝐭𝐫𝐞𝐚𝐦, 𝐃𝐮𝐚𝐥-𝐁𝐚𝐧𝐝 𝐖𝐢-𝐅𝐢 𝐰𝐢𝐭𝐡 𝟔.𝟓 𝐆𝐛𝐩𝐬 𝐓𝐨𝐭𝐚𝐥 𝐁𝐚𝐧𝐝𝐰𝐢𝐝𝐭𝐡 - Achieve full speeds of up to 5764 Mbps on the 5GHz band and 688 Mbps on the 2.4 GHz band with 6 streams. Enjoy seamless 4K/8K streaming, AR/VR gaming, and incredibly fast downloads/uploads.

- 𝐖𝐢𝐝𝐞 𝐂𝐨𝐯𝐞𝐫𝐚𝐠𝐞 𝐰𝐢𝐭𝐡 𝐒𝐭𝐫𝐨𝐧𝐠 𝐂𝐨𝐧𝐧𝐞𝐜𝐭𝐢𝐨𝐧 - Get up to 2,400 sq. ft. max coverage for up to 90 devices at a time. 6x high performance antennas and Beamforming technology, ensures reliable connections for remote workers, gamers, students, and more.

- 𝐔𝐥𝐭𝐫𝐚-𝐅𝐚𝐬𝐭 𝟐.𝟓 𝐆𝐛𝐩𝐬 𝐖𝐢𝐫𝐞𝐝 𝐏𝐞𝐫𝐟𝐨𝐫𝐦𝐚𝐧𝐜𝐞 - 1x 2.5 Gbps WAN/LAN port, 1x 2.5 Gbps LAN port and 3x 1 Gbps LAN ports offer high-speed data transmissions.³ Integrate with a multi-gig modem for gigplus internet.
